🌸 1. Loose Beachy Waves with Middle Part

Why it’s boho:
It doesn’t get more boho-classic than this. These relaxed waves paired with a center part give off serious barefoot-at-the-beach vibes.

Best for: Medium to long wavy hair

Styling tip: Spritz sea salt spray on damp hair and scrunch. Let it air dry or diffuse for a natural, lived-in texture.

🌼 2. Boho Braided Crown with Waves

Why it’s ethereal:
This romantic style weaves your hair into a halo braid that wraps around your head, while the rest flows in loose waves.

Best for: Weddings, festivals, or outdoor events

Styling tip: Use a texturizing spray before braiding to add grip. Pin with bobby pins and let your natural waves shine beneath the braid.

🎀 3. Half-Up Twisted Waves

Why it’s playful:
Half-up hairstyles are a boho favorite, and twisting small sections before pinning adds a unique, earthy touch.

Best for: Shoulder-length and longer hair

Styling tip: Add face-framing tendrils and decorate with tiny flowers or beads for a whimsical finish.

🧣 4. Wavy Hair with Scarf Wrap

Why it’s fun:
Scarves are a quintessential boho accessory. Wrap one around a half-up ponytail or turban-style for instant boho glam.

Best for: All wavy hair types

Styling tip: Choose a floral or paisley scarf. Tie loosely to avoid flattening your waves.

🌿 5. Side Braid with Soft Waves

Why it’s effortless:
A chunky side braid brings boho charm while letting your waves cascade naturally over one shoulder.

Best for: Long wavy hair

Styling tip: Loosely braid one side and pull it apart slightly to create a “lived-in” texture. Secure with a clear elastic.

✨ 6. Bohemian Bubble Braid

Why it’s bold:
This creative alternative to a traditional braid adds volume and uniqueness to your look, especially when combined with waves.

Best for: Medium to long hair

Styling tip: Tie hair in a ponytail, add elastics every few inches, and gently tug at each “bubble” to fluff it out. Wave the ends with a curling wand if needed.

🌸 7. Textured Low Bun with Loose Strands

Why it’s dreamy:
A low bun with pulled-out waves around the face and neck gives an undone, romantic look — perfect for boho weddings or date nights.

Best for: Shoulder-length and longer hair

Styling tip: Tease the crown for volume, twist the bun loosely, and secure with bobby pins. Finish with a light hold hairspray.

🌺 8. Flower-Adorned Wavy Hair

Why it’s enchanting:
Nothing says boho like flowers in your hair. Whether real or faux, they instantly elevate a wavy hairstyle.

Best for: Special occasions and festivals

Styling tip: Place flower pins or clips along braids or randomly throughout your waves. Avoid overcrowding for a natural effect.

🎨 9. Wavy Hair with Mini Braids

Why it’s artistic:
Scattered small braids within natural waves give your hair a free-spirited, tribal-inspired vibe.

Best for: All lengths of wavy hair

Styling tip: Take random sections, braid tightly, and secure with micro elastics. Leave the rest of your hair tousled and unstyled.

🌾 10. Crimped Waves with Fringe

Why it’s retro-boho:
Crimped texture adds a funky throwback to your boho look. Pair it with curtain bangs or a wispy fringe for a modern edge.

Best for: Medium to thick hair

Styling tip: Use a micro-crimper on select sections or braid damp hair overnight and unravel in the morning.

💫 11. Boho Fishtail on Loose Waves

Why it’s intricate:
Fishtail braids add texture and elegance while keeping your overall style relaxed.

Best for: Long wavy hair

Styling tip: Start a loose fishtail braid off to the side or incorporate it into a half-up look. Pull apart the braid gently for volume.

👑 12. Wavy Hair with Head Chains

Why it’s regal:
A delicate chain or boho headpiece draped across loose waves transforms your hair into a crown-worthy masterpiece.

Best for: Weddings, concerts, photoshoots

Styling tip: Choose gold or silver chains with small accents (feathers, stones). Style hair in middle part waves and rest the chain flat against the crown.

🌀 13. Festival-Inspired Space Buns + Waves

Why it’s youthful:
This playful look combines two mini buns on top with flowing wavy hair underneath. It’s ideal for fun events and summer vibes.

Best for: Shoulder-length or longer hair

Styling tip: Part your hair down the middle, twist top sections into buns, and leave the rest wavy and free.

🎀 14. Boho Half-Up Knot

Why it’s minimalist boho:
A knotted half-updo is sleek yet still relaxed — the perfect blend of structure and bohemian flow.

Best for: Medium-length wavy hair

Styling tip: Tie two front sections in a knot at the back of your head. Secure with pins and let the rest of your waves fall free.

🍂 15. Layered Boho Waves with Face-Framing Pieces

Why it’s timeless:
Subtle layers and soft face-framing strands elevate everyday waves into a signature boho look.

Best for: Medium to long hair

Styling tip: Use a large-barrel wand to define a few face-framing pieces while letting the rest of your hair dry naturally.

How to Create Boho Waves Without Heat

Want the look but don’t want the damage? Try these heat-free boho wave techniques:

  • Braiding damp hair overnight
  • Twisting sections into buns while damp
  • Using foam rollers
  • Applying sea salt spray and air-drying
  • Using a wave ribbon or heatless curl rod

Let your hair do its thing — the more natural, the better.
